IBD: Paul Katzeff: The Painless Way To Add $140,000 To Your Retirement Account

FYI: Buoyed by an ongoing bull market, retirement savings balances kept rising in the first quarter, as reflected in accounts run by Fidelity Investments. The average 401(k) balance in plans whose records are kept by Fidelity hit a record $95,500 by March 31, according to newly released Fidelity data. That was a 9% jump in a year. IRAs also hit an all-time high of $98,100, an increase of almost 10%.
